Stone Wall Replacement in Boston, MA
Stone wall replacement services involve removing and rebuilding existing stone walls that have become damaged, deteriorated, or no longer serve their intended purpose. These projects typically include replacing crumbling or unstable stones, restoring retaining walls, boundary walls, garden borders, or decorative features. Homeowners often seek this service to enhance the stability and appearance of their property, prevent erosion, or update aging structures to improve curb appeal.
Before requesting stone wall replacement,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the condition of existing materials and the types of stones suitable for replacement. It is also helpful to consider the overall design and function of the new wall, whether it will serve as a boundary, retaining structure, or decorative element. Clarifying these details can ensure the project aligns with property goals and maintains the aesthetic integrity of the landscape.

Stone Wall Replacement Questions
What are common reasons for stone wall replacement? Damage from weather, shifting foundations, or deterioration over time can necessitate replacement of stone walls.
How can I tell if my stone wall needs replacement? Signs include loose or crumbling stones, leaning structures, or visible cracks indicating instability.
What types of projects typically require stone wall replacement? Retrofitting old garden walls, repairing retaining walls, or rebuilding damaged boundary walls are common projects.
What should property owners consider before replacing a stone wall? Assess the wall’s condition, desired aesthetic, and compatibility with surrounding landscape to plan effectively.
